This kit with its convincing performance can be classified as a solid midrange 50cc cylinder.Due to excellent workmanship, equipped with 6 transfer ports and a divided bridged exhaust port, this kit is powerful and very durable as well which makes it an ideal cylinder for everyday use. Great choice if you want to remain 50cc, but are looking for more power!
To get the most out of this cylinder kit, we recommend combining it with a 15mm carburetor (minimum) and a sports exhaust.
The kit does not include a cylinder head; we recommend using a high-compression cylinder head (sold separately) to exploit its full potential.
Street-legal.
Note: If you want to mount this kit on a Peugeot Fox, you'll have to use a sports exhaust! Using the original exhaust would require modifications to the exhaust flange.

Aluminium cylinders
Aluminium cylinders are more powerful than cast iron cylinders, but require more regular maintenance and must be combined with different components such as a reinforced crankshaft and a larger carburetor.
How to run in an aluminium cylinder?
Aluminium cylinders should be run in for about 200 kilometers , and you should use a fully synthetic engine oil.
